Brief summary

The objective of this study is to test the feasibility of using behavioral economic interventions (gamification with social incentives) targeting daily step counts to prevent or delay the development of Alzheimer's Disease and Related Dementias (ADRD).

Detailed description

Increased physical activity by walking further or more vigorously may prevent or delay the development of Alzheimer's Disease and Related Dementias (ADRD) but reaching higher levels of activity and maintaining it as a long-term habit is difficult to do. This project will use concepts from behavioral science to create a game older adults can play in order to increase their levels of activity while having fun doing it. The game is played with a support partner who is a spouse, family member, or close friend who provides feedback and encouragement to help the game-player reach activity goals and maintain them as habits over time. Participants in the game will use their own smartphone and a wristwatch that tracks activity (such as a FitBit, provided by this study) to set goals, get feedback, and play the game for 12 weeks. Participants will be asked to continue wearing the wristwatch for another 6 weeks to track activity after the game is over. To determine the effectiveness of this game, investigators will randomly assign 50 people to the game and 50 people to only get the wristwatch but no game component. All participants in this study will be recruited from an online registry of adults age 55-75 who have not been diagnosed with Alzheimer's (GeneMatch) which offers genetic testing on risk for ADRD to all participants. Investigators will recruit participants who have elevated genetic risk as well as those without specific genetic risks for the study to see if either group responds differently to the game.

Interventions

BEHAVIORALGamification

Each participant signs a pre-commitment contract agreeing to try their best to achieve their daily step goal. Each week over the 12 week intervention period, participants are endowed 70 points (10/day). Participants are informed they will lose 10 points for each day the step goal is not met. Points are replenished at the start of the week. At the end of the week, if the participant has 40 points or more, he/she will advance one level, or drop one level if they have less than 40 points. The levels include: blue (lowest), bronze, silver, gold, platinum (highest). Each participant begins in the middle (silver). Each participant will also select a spouse, family member, or friend that they see often to serve as a supportive sponsor that receives a weekly email participants progress including points, game level, and average step countThis supportive sponsor will help to enhance social incentives to motivate the individual towards his or her goal.

Intervention model description

This is a 2-arm, randomized, controlled trial over 12 weeks with 6 weeks of follow-up (18 weeks total) that compares a control group that uses a wearable device to track physical activity to an intervention group that uses the same wearable devices and receives a supportive social incentive-based gamification intervention to adhere to a step goal program.

Participant flow

Recruitment details

After a participant consented to participating in the study, they are given a Fitbit device to wear for a 2 week run-in period to collect step and sleep data to estimate their 2-week baseline. Participants with a baseline above 7500 are excluded from the study due to them being too active.

Pre-assignment details

240 participants were officially consented and enrolled per study design protocol. Out of 240, 137 are deemed ineligible due to high baseline (\>7500 steps) during the 2-week run-in or did not complete all recruitment steps before the study closed for enrollment. Out of 103 randomized, 9 from the intervention arm dropped before starting the study.

Outcome results

Primary

Change in Mean Daily Steps From the Baseline Period to the End of the 12 Week Intervention Period.

The primary outcome of the study is the change in mean daily steps from the baseline period to the end of the 12 week intervention period collected by Fitbit Inspire device.

Time frame: Baseline to 12 week intervention period (Weeks 1 - 12)

ArmMeasureValue (MEAN)Dispersion
ControlChange in Mean Daily Steps From the Baseline Period to the End of the 12 Week Intervention Period.735 stepsStandard Deviation 1306
GamificationChange in Mean Daily Steps From the Baseline Period to the End of the 12 Week Intervention Period.2422 stepsStandard Deviation 1460
Secondary

Change in Mean Daily Step Counts During the 6 Week Follow-up Period After the End of the Intervention Period Tracked by Fitbit Inspire Device.

The secondary outcome will examine the change in mean daily step counts during the 6 week follow-up period after the end of the 12 week intervention period.

Time frame: 6 week follow-up period (Weeks 13 - 18)

ArmMeasureValue (MEAN)Dispersion
ControlChange in Mean Daily Step Counts During the 6 Week Follow-up Period After the End of the Intervention Period Tracked by Fitbit Inspire Device.705 stepsStandard Deviation 1916
GamificationChange in Mean Daily Step Counts During the 6 Week Follow-up Period After the End of the Intervention Period Tracked by Fitbit Inspire Device.1983 stepsStandard Deviation 1478
